Belgian Jupiler Pro League champions Club Brugge are set to complete the signing of Super Eagles-eligible attacker Wisdom Mike, Soccernet.ng reports.
Mike joined Bayern Munich’s academy from Borussia Mönchengladbach in 2022 and has since risen through the ranks to the reserve team at just 17 years old.
Last season, the promising youngster made his Bundesliga debut for Bayern’s senior side, logging four substitute appearances. Mike stands out for his pace, dribbling, sharp ball control, and two-footedness, which allows him to operate effectively on either flank.

However, given the fierce competition in Bayern’s squad, first-team minutes remained limited—a situation unlikely to change in the upcoming campaign. Seeking regular senior playing time to sustain his development, a move away became the practical choice.

Following weeks of speculation, transfer expert Florian Plettenberg confirmed that Mike will join Club Brugge on a permanent deal. The Belgian outfit will pay an initial fee of €5 million, alongside performance-related add-ons and a sell-on clause.
Can Wisdom Mike Play for the Super Eagles?
A regular starting role at Club Brugge will definitely accelerate Mike’s development, and that will bring his international future into focus.
Born in Germany to Nigerian parents, Mike is eligible to represent any of the two countries. But in the meantime, he is currently an active German youth international, having featured at the U-15, U-16, and U-17 levels.
Since a senior German call-up remains unlikely in the short term, the door stays wide open for Nigeria. As long as he does not make a competitive senior appearance for Germany, he remains eligible for the Super Eagles and could develop into a valuable asset for the national team if he decides to switch allegiances.
